Gravel in a 1.5" Minus Size Range
1.5" minus gravel is a versatile construction aggregate consisting of crushed stone and fines, with individual pieces ranging up to 1.5 inches in diameter. The "minus" designation means the material includes a mix of larger stones and smaller particles, which helps it compact tightly and form a stable base.
This size and gradation make 1.5" minus gravel ideal for foundational work, such as road base, driveway sub-base, and under concrete slabs. The blend of coarse and fine particles ensures excellent load-bearing capacity and reduces voids, minimizing shifting and settling over time. While it compacts well for structural support, the presence of fines means it is less suitable for drainage applications compared to clean or washed gravel. Overall, 1.5" minus gravel is a reliable choice for both residential and commercial projects requiring a strong, compacted base.
